Weaving a Tapestry of Tastes and Tunes
A craft fair is as much about the senses as it is about the hands. To elevate the party, curate a culinary and auditory experience that mirrors the season’s richness. Set up a long, communal table laden with a harvest feast: a steaming pot of butternut squash soup, a crusty loaf of sourdough, and a platter of sharp cheeses and crisp apples. The centerpiece, of course, is a warm beverage station offering spiced apple cider, chai lattes, and perhaps a mulled wine for the adults. As guests sip and sample, let the soundtrack be an acoustic folk playlist or a local fiddler playing lively, foot-stomping tunes. The music should be present but never overwhelming, providing a gentle backdrop that encourages conversation and laughter. This fusion of craft, cuisine, and melody creates a holistic environment where the joy of creation is matched only by the pleasure of togetherness.
Hands-On Enchantment for All
To truly transform a fair into a party, the experience must be interactive. Set aside a dedicated “Make-and-Take” tent or corner where guests can roll up their sleeves and try their hand at a simple craft. Perhaps a leaf-printing station using fabric paints and real autumn leaves, or a miniature pumpkin-decorating table with an array of ribbons, glitter, and natural twigs. For a more meditative activity, offer a session on making dried orange slice garlands or beeswax candle rolling. These hands-on workshops are not just about creating a souvenir; they are about forging a connection with the materials and the season. Children and adults alike will be captivated by the process, and the shared experience of learning together dissolves barriers, sparking new friendships and memories that will last long after the last leaf has fallen.
